Thursday September 28: Diving in the Red Sea

Start your adventure in Sharm El Sheikh by exploring the stunning underwater world of the Red Sea. In the morning, head to Ras Mohammed National Park, a renowned diving destination. Dive into crystal clear waters, filled with vibrant coral reefs and exotic marine life. Spend the afternoon exploring different dive sites, such as Shark Reef and Yolanda Reef, known for their abundance of colorful fish and unique underwater landscapes. As the evening approaches, relax on the white sandy beaches and witness a breathtaking sunset over the Red Sea.

  • Ras Mohammed National Park: Cost Estimate: $50 for diving equipment rental, Time Spent: 4-6 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For adventure enthusiasts looking for off the beaten path attractions, the Colored Canyon is a must-visit. Located about 2 hours from Sharm El Sheikh, this unique natural wonder is known for its vibrant colors and narrow passageways. Take a guided hike through the canyon and marvel at the mesmerizing rock formations. Another local favorite is St. Catherine's Monastery, situated at the foot of Mount Sinai. This ancient UNESCO World Heritage site offers a glimpse into the rich history and religious significance of the region. Don't miss the opportunity to climb Mount Sinai for a breathtaking sunrise or sunset experience.
